Definitions:

Trachea

A large tube in the respiratory system that connects the larynx to the bronchi, allowing air passage to the lungs.

Terminal Bronchioles

The smallest air passageways in the lungs before the alveolar ducts and alveoli, involved in conducting air to the gas exchange sites.

Pleural Fluid

A liquid that fills the space between the layers of the pleura, the membrane surrounding the lungs, acting as a lubricant.

Parietal Pleura

The part of the pleura that lines the inner surface of the chest wall and diaphragm, playing a role in the breathing process.
